About This Dive Spot

Underwater Triglav is a deep blue-water dive to the deepest point in Slovenia, suited to advanced and expert divers. It becomes quite dark toward the bottom and is often used for deep-water training. The bottom is mostly mud, with the deepest point marked by a small artificial pyramid.
